This song was written and recorded via the Dutch brothers Rob and Ferdi Bolland in 1981. Five years later, the British rock band Status Quo coated it since the title observe of their 1986 album. In spite of remaining totally diverse to Quo’s standard 12-bar boogie structure, it absolutely was released as a single.

It proved being an astute move as being the song turned one of many team's greatest at any time offering hits, peaking at #two in the UK and topping many charts in Europe, together with People of Austria, Germany and Switzerland.
